The station is thoughtfully equipped with a range of facilities to ensure comfort and convenience for travelers. The ticket office operates from as early as 06:20 AM during weekdays and offers services until 10:00 PM, making it accessible for various schedules. Additionally, ticket machines are available for quick access, including those that are accessible, ensuring that everyone can handle their ticketing efficiently regardless of time constraints. Travelers can collect tickets bought online at the station, which is a boon for those who prefer to plan their journeys digitally.
Step-free access is partially available at this Category B station, with accessible routes leading to platform 2 and alternative routes via the roadbridge. However, some platforms may have noticeable stepping distances, so passengers should remain vigilant when boarding. There's ample space for accessible parking, with 13 dedicated bays, and even though accessible taxis aren’t present, assistance can be requested to smoothen the journey. The station ensures safety with CCTV, and help is available from 06:20 AM to 10:00 PM throughout the week.

While the station might be small, it has its fair share of amenities tailored for seamless travel.
While Bootle (Cumbria) Station doesn't boast a bustling ticket office, it makes up for this with practical ticket machines from which you can collect tickets purchased online. If you’re reliant on accessible infrastructure, rest assured that there are accessible ticket machines available. Despite there being no staff on site, help is just a call away via a dedicated helpline at 08002006060. Commuters with hearing impairments can benefit from the induction loop, ensuring communication is hassle-free.
Accessibility is a key feature at Bootle station, as it provides a step-free experience across both platforms, which is crucial for passengers with limited mobility. While there are no permanent staff members to assist directly at the station, assistance is nonetheless available, with the help of conductors who are ready to provide support as you board. If you need to continue your journey beyond Bootle, there are a few transport options available. The rail replacement services offer pick-up and drop-off at the nearby bus shelter outside the Hycemoor Hotel. Alternatively, local taxi services can be arranged, providing another convenient means to reach your destination. For those preferring to cycle, although Bootle Station itself doesn’t offer bicycle hire, you can store your bike on the stands available at Platform 1.
